By watching the USDx indicator, you are looking on just one side of the coin.
If one other currency (x) is much stronger compared to a rising USD – that will be the result.
In those cases I still DON’T trade against a rising USD, and search for a weaker currency, pointing down, to trade against currency (x).

Those numbers are from the BIS (The Bank for International Settlements), and NOT calculated.
Their sum is 66.6%, and I scale them to 100% and calculate each pair by that factor.
I use in both a Stand-Alone USDx indicator and my Spaghetti indicator.
I never trade AGAINST the USDx indie.
